This beautiful ceramic cheese board, also perfect as a coaster, is a fine example of 1950s design. Although it does not bear a signature, it is attributed to boch frères keralux, a famous belgian faience manufacturer, and designed by the talented raymond chevalier in 1958. Characteristics: material: high-quality glossy ceramic colours: shades of ochre to hazelnut with a refined straw decor typical of mid-century design dimensions: 31 cm X 20 cm X 3 cm origin: attributed to boch frères, keralux, belgium condition: very good overall condition, ideal for decorative use or display about boch frères and keralux founded in belgium, the faience manufacturer boch frères is known for its craftsmanship and design pieces, often associated with 20th-century modernity. The keralux collection, created in the 1950s, is a perfect example of the combination of function and aesthetics, thanks to artists such as raymond chevalier, known for his minimalist and elegant decors.
